Jamstack

JAMstack, JAM stack, JavaScript API Markup stack, static site architecture
Jamstack is een architectuur waarbij je statische HTML genereert, via API's data ophaalt en via CDN serveert. Het levert snelle, veilige websites op.

Wat is Jamstack?

Jamstack is een moderne webarchitectuur waarbij je statische HTML-pagina's vooraf genereert, dynamische content via API's ophaalt en het geheel via een CDN (Content Delivery Network) serveert. De naam staat voor JavaScript, API's en Markup. In plaats van een traditionele server die bij elk bezoek een pagina samenstelt, bouw je met Jamstack alle pagina's tijdens de deployment. Het resultaat is een verzameling statische bestanden die razendsnel laden en makkelijk schaalbaar zijn. Voor MKB-bedrijven betekent dit snellere websites, lagere hostingkosten en minder beveiligingsrisico's.

Hoe Jamstack werkt in de praktijk

Bij een Jamstack-site gebruik je een static site generator zoals Next.js, Gatsby of Astro. Die tool haalt content uit je CMS, database of markdown-bestanden en genereert daaruit complete HTML-pagina's. Die pagina's upload je naar een CDN, zodat bezoekers altijd de dichtstbijzijnde kopie krijgen. Dynamische functies zoals een contactformulier, zoekfunctie of productfilter los je op met JavaScript die rechtstreeks API's aanroept. Denk aan een headless CMS zoals Contentful of Strapi, een e-commerce-backend zoals Shopify, of een zoek-API zoals Algolia. De browser haalt real-time data op zonder dat je server bij elk verzoek een pagina moet bouwen.

Waarom Jamstack ontstond en waarom het nu relevant is

Jamstack kwam op als reactie op trage, kwetsbare monolithische systemen zoals WordPress met plugins die elkaar tegenwerkten. Ontwikkelaars zochten een manier om de snelheid van statische sites te combineren met de flexibiliteit van dynamische applicaties. Door de opkomst van headless CMS-systemen, serverless functies en krachtige front-end frameworks werd deze aanpak vanaf circa 2016 praktisch haalbaar. Vandaag is Jamstack relevant omdat Google Core Web Vitals snelheid beloont, omdat cybersecurity-risico's toenemen en omdat MKB-bedrijven schaalbare oplossingen nodig hebben zonder dure server-infrastructuur. Je betaalt niet voor een server die 24/7 draait, maar alleen voor de bandbreedte die je CDN gebruikt.

Wat Jamstack oplevert voor MKB-bedrijven

Met Jamstack krijg je een website die binnen 1 seconde laadt, zelfs bij piekverkeer. Dat verbetert je positie in Google en verhoogt conversie. Omdat er geen database of CMS rechtstreeks toegankelijk is voor hackers, verminder je beveiligingsrisico's aanzienlijk. Hostingkosten dalen vaak met 60 tot 80 procent vergeleken met traditionele hosting, omdat je alleen een CDN en eventueel serverless functies betaalt. Voor bedrijven die een website laten maken met veel content maar weinig real-time interactie is dit ideaal. Denk aan portfoliosites, blogs, kennisbanken of productcatalogi. Een Jamstack-architectuur past goed bij een doordachte front-end-strategie waarin snelheid en gebruikerservaring centraal staan.

Toepassingen van Jamstack

Jamstack is niet voor elk project de beste keuze, maar voor specifieke situaties levert het een duidelijk voordeel op. Hieronder zie je vier concrete toepassingen waarin MKB-bedrijven profiteren van deze architectuur, plus een besliscriterium wanneer je beter een andere aanpak kiest.

Content-gedreven websites met weinig real-time interactie

Denk aan een kennisbank, blogplatform, portfoliosite of productcatalogus. Als je content regelmatig wijzigt maar niet seconde-op-seconde live hoeft te zijn, is Jamstack perfect. Je bouwt de site opnieuw bij elke content-update en pusht de nieuwe versie naar je CDN. Een MKB-adviesbureau met 200 blogartikelen en 15 casestudies kan zo'n site binnen 30 seconden opnieuw deployen. Bezoekers krijgen altijd de nieuwste versie, maar zonder de overhead van een database-query bij elk bezoek. Dit werkt goed als je een headless CMS gebruikt waarin redacteuren content beheren, terwijl de front-end volledig statisch blijft. De combinatie van snelheid en gemak maakt dit een populaire keuze voor bedrijven die SEO serieus nemen.

E-commerce met externe productdata

Een webshop met 500 producten kan Jamstack gebruiken voor de productpagina's, terwijl winkelwagen, checkout en voorraad via API's lopen. Je genereert statische pagina's voor elk product, zodat die razendsnel laden. Real-time functies zoals beschikbaarheid, prijzen of aanbiedingen haal je op via een API van je e-commerce-backend, bijvoorbeeld Shopify of een custom API-integratie. Dit geeft je het beste van beide werelden: snelle SEO-vriendelijke productpagina's en actuele voorraaddata. Een webshop in outdoor-gear zag laadtijden dalen van 4 naar 1,2 seconden door productpagina's statisch te maken, terwijl de checkout dynamisch bleef. Let wel: als je duizenden producten hebt die dagelijks wijzigen, wordt herbouwen tijdrovend. Dan is incremental static regeneration of een hybride aanpak slimmer.

Marketing-landingspagina's en campagnesites

Voor tijdelijke campagnes, events of productlanceringen is Jamstack ideaal. Je bouwt een snelle, veilige landingspagina zonder zorgen over server-capaciteit tijdens piekverkeer. Een B2B-softwarebedrijf lanceerde een campagnesite voor een webinar met 2.000 aanmeldingen in twee dagen. Omdat de site via CDN liep, was er geen downtime en geen extra serverkosten. Formulieren verstuur je via een serverless functie naar je CRM of e-mailmarketing-tool. Na de campagne zet je de site uit of archiveer je hem zonder maandelijkse hostingkosten. Dit werkt vooral goed als je snel wilt itereren: A/B-testen, nieuwe content toevoegen en direct live pushen zonder deployment-rompslomp. De combinatie met web development-expertise zorgt dat je binnen een dag een productie-klare campagnesite hebt.

Wanneer Jamstack de juiste keuze is en wanneer niet

Jamstack past goed als je content niet seconde-op-seconde verandert, als je snelheid en beveiliging prioriteit geeft, en als je development-team bekend is met moderne front-end frameworks. Het werkt minder goed voor applicaties met veel real-time gebruikersinteractie, zoals een social platform, een live dashboard of een SaaS-tool met persoonlijke data per gebruiker. Ook bij enorme catalogi met dagelijkse updates (denk aan 50.000 producten) wordt herbouwen traag en kostbaar. In die gevallen is een hybride aanpak of server-side rendering realistischer. Vraag jezelf af: verandert mijn content vaker dan eens per uur? Hebben gebruikers gepersonaliseerde views? Zo ja, overweeg dan een traditionele back-end-architectuur of een framework zoals Next.js dat server-side rendering combineert met static generation.

Wil je dit toepassen in jouw bedrijf? Monkey Vision helpt MKB-ondernemers met webdesign, SEO en slimme digitale oplossingen. Plan een vrijblijvende kennismaking en ontdek wat er voor jou mogelijk is.

Plan een kennismaking

Veelgestelde vragen

Nee, Jamstack gaat verder dan een klassieke statische site. Een traditionele statische website bestaat uit handmatig geschreven HTML-bestanden zonder dynamische functies. Jamstack genereert die HTML automatisch uit een CMS of database en voegt dynamische mogelijkheden toe via API's en JavaScript. Je kunt bijvoorbeeld een zoekfunctie, live chat of productfilter inbouwen zonder dat je server bij elk bezoek een pagina moet renderen. Het verschil zit in de workflow: bij Jamstack automatiseer je de build en integreer je externe services, terwijl een statische site vaak handwerk blijft. Voor een MKB-bedrijf betekent dit dat je de snelheid van statisch combineert met de flexibiliteit van dynamisch.

Kies Jamstack als snelheid, beveiliging en lage hostingkosten prioriteit hebben en je development-team comfortabel is met moderne frameworks. WordPress is handiger als je een groot redactieteam hebt dat zonder technische kennis content wil publiceren, of als je afhankelijk bent van specifieke plugins die geen API-equivalent hebben. In de praktijk zien we dat MKB-bedrijven met een contentsite of portfoliosite vaak beter af zijn met Jamstack, terwijl bedrijven met complexe workflows, gebruikersrollen of legacy-integraties bij WordPress blijven. Een hybride aanpak is ook mogelijk: WordPress als headless CMS met een Jamstack-front-end. Zo houd je de vertrouwde editor en krijg je toch de snelheid van statische HTML.

Start met een duidelijk doel: wil je een snellere website, lagere kosten of betere beveiliging? Kies vervolgens een static site generator die past bij je team, bijvoorbeeld Next.js als je React kent of Astro voor eenvoud. Selecteer een headless CMS zoals Contentful, Sanity of Strapi voor contentbeheer. Zorg dat je deployment automatiseert via een platform zoals Vercel, Netlify of Cloudflare Pages. Begin klein: bouw eerst een landingspagina of bloggedeelte om de workflow te testen. Pas daarna breid je uit naar de volledige site. In de praktijk duurt een eerste Jamstack-project voor een MKB-site 4 tot 8 weken, afhankelijk van complexiteit en integraties. Heb je geen development-team in huis, schakel dan een bureau in dat ervaring heeft met moderne web development en API-koppelingen.

De beste aanpak hangt af van je huidige situatie en ambities. Heb je al een website maar wil je sneller, veiliger en goedkoper hosten? Of start je vanaf nul met een nieuw platform? Plan een gratis website-scan van 30 minuten bij Monkey Vision. We lopen live door je huidige setup, bespreken of Jamstack past bij jouw content-workflow en geven drie concrete verbeterpunten die je deze maand kunt oppakken. Je krijgt een eerlijke inschatting van doorlooptijd, kosten en groeipotentieel, zonder verkooppraatje. Boek direct via webdesign bij Monkey Vision en ontdek welke architectuur het beste bij jouw bedrijf past.

Over de auteur

Monkey Vision

Monkey Vision is een full-service digitaal bureau in Nijmegen, gespecialiseerd in webdesign, SEO en AI-automatisering voor het MKB. De kennisbank is samengesteld door ons team van online-strategen en doorlopend bijgehouden op basis van actuele inzichten.

Publicatiedatum: 26-04-2026
Laatste update: 26-04-2026